7.1.1.2 USB Type-C Cables
Below is a list of Type-C cables types supported by the TUSB320 device:
USB full-featured Type-C cable
USB2.0 Type-C cable with USB2.0 plug
Captive cable with either a USB full-featured plug or USB2.0 plug
7.1.1.3 Legacy Cables and Adapters
The TUSB320 device supports legacy cable adapters as defined by the Type-C Specification. The cable adapter
must correspond to the mode configuration of the TUSB320 device.

7.1.1.4 Direct Connect Devices
The TUSB320 device supports the attaching and detaching of a direct-connect device.
7.1.1.5 Audio Adapters
Additionally, the TUSB320 device supports audio adapters for audio accessory mode, including:
Passive Audio Adapter
Charge Through Audio Adapter
7.2 Feature Description
7.2.1 Port Role Configuration
The TUSB320 device can be configured as a downstream facing port (DFP), upstream facing port (UFP), or
dualrole port (DRP) using the tri-level PORT pin. The PORT pin should be pulled high to VDD using a pullup
resistance, low to GND or left as floated on the PCB to achieve the desired mode. This flexibility allows the
TUSB320 device to be used in a variety of applications. The TUSB320 device samples the PORT pin after reset
and maintains the desired mode until the TUSB320 device is reset again. Table 1 lists the supported features in
